Crab pots vandalized in the Harbour.
Quite a few weeks ago I set 6 crab pots just to the west of Preston Point. I was at least 1km from both Inpex and Wickam Point gas facilities. I came back about 3 hours later to find all of them cut open and the baits removed. I assume this was done by gas plant staff monitoring the area? But I don't see why this location is 'obviously' off limits. There are Catalina wrecks very closed by, as marked in the Bible for fishing. There were no ships around. Am I missing something? Slashing 6 near new crab pots is just poor form, no matter who it was. I'd love to know people's thoughts on this.
